  • Patent number: 11931504
    Abstract: An inhaler with an inner housing with a pressurised reservoir of an inhalable composition. A breath operated valve is operable by a user inhaling on an inhaling end of the inhaler. A composition flow path extends from the breath operated valve to the inhaling end via which the composition is dispensed when the breath operated valve is opened. The breath operated valve is biased closed by a biasing member contacting the breath operated valve at one end. A bung in the inner housing is positioned in an opening in the inner housing to support the end of the biasing member opposite to the breath operated valve. A rigid outer housing surrounds the inner housing and supports the bung.

  • Publication number: 20240033458
    Abstract: Described herein is a respiratory therapy system comprising: a primary power supply, a secondary power supply, and a breathing apparatus configured to provide respiratory therapy. The breathing apparatus comprises a controller. There is a connection between the primary power supply and the breathing apparatus configured to facilitate transmission of power and data between the primary power supply and the breathing apparatus. The controller is configured to monitor a parameter of the primary power supply, and disengage the primary power supply if the parameter differs from a parameter threshold. The controller is configured to engage the secondary power supply on disconnection of the primary power supply such that the breathing apparatus can continue operation without interruption.

  • Patent number: 10177902
    Abstract: Systems and methods for processing data including a first and second component are described. An example circuit includes a processing stage arranged to calculate absolute values of the first component and the second component, and to output, at a first output, a maximum value of the absolute value of the first component and the absolute value of the second component, and, at a second output, a minimum value of the absolute value of the first component and the absolute value of the second component. The circuit includes a processing stage arranged to output, in response to the maximum value being greater than the minimum value times four, a value corresponding to the maximum value, and to output, in response to the maximum value being smaller than the minimum value times four, a value corresponding to a sum of seven times the maximum value and four times the minimum value.
